PTFE seals, also known as Teflon seals, are essential components in various industrial applications These seals are made from polytetrafluoroethylene (PTFE), a synthetic polymer that offers exceptional properties such as chemical resistance, low friction, and high temperature resistance PTFE seals are widely used in industries such as automotive, aerospace, pharmaceutical, and manufacturing due to their reliability and effectiveness in preventing leaks and ensuring smooth operation of machinery and equipment.
One of the key characteristics of PTFE seals is their excellent chemical resistance PTFE is inert to almost all chemicals, including acids, bases, and solvents This makes PTFE seals ideal for applications where exposure to corrosive substances is common In industries such as chemical processing, oil and gas, and pharmaceuticals, where the risk of chemical spills or leaks is high, PTFE seals provide a reliable barrier that prevents fluids from escaping and causing contamination.
Another important property of PTFE seals is their low friction coefficient PTFE is known for its slippery surface, which reduces friction and allows for smooth and efficient operation of moving parts This low friction characteristic of PTFE seals is especially beneficial in applications where components need to move freely without experiencing excessive wear or heat buildup For example, in automotive engines, PTFE seals are used to prevent oil leakage and reduce friction between moving parts, thereby improving fuel efficiency and prolonging the lifespan of the engine.
Furthermore, PTFE seals have a high temperature resistance, making them suitable for applications that involve extreme heat or rapid temperature changes PTFE can withstand temperatures ranging from -200°C to 260°C, without losing its structural integrity or mechanical properties This thermal stability of PTFE seals makes them ideal for use in industries such as aerospace, where components are subjected to high temperatures during flight or space missions ptfe seal. PTFE seals ensure that critical systems remain sealed and functioning properly, even under extreme environmental conditions.
In addition to their chemical resistance, low friction, and high temperature resistance, PTFE seals also offer excellent sealing properties PTFE is a soft and pliable material that conforms easily to irregular surfaces, creating a tight seal that prevents leaks and ingress of contaminants This sealing capability of PTFE seals is crucial in industries such as food and beverage, where hygiene and cleanliness are paramount PTFE seals are used in equipment such as pumps, valves, and pipelines to maintain a sterile environment and ensure product integrity.
